Background

Pragmatic trials provide evidence from the real world that can be used to make clinical decisions. The term "pragmatic" however, is used inconsistently and its definition and evaluation require further clarification. The purpose of pragmatic trials is to guide the practice of clinical medicine and policy decisions, not to verify a physiological hypothesis or clinical hypothesis. A pragmatic trial should also aim to be as similar to the real-world clinical environment as possible, such as its selection of participants, setting and design as well as the execution of the intervention, and the determination and analysis of outcomes and primary analyses. This is a significant distinction from explanation trials (as described by Schwartz and Lellouch1), which are intended to provide a more thorough confirmation of an idea.

Truely pragmatic trials should not be blind participants or the clinicians. This could lead to a bias in the estimates of the effects of treatment. Pragmatic trials should also seek to recruit patients from a variety of health care settings, so that their results are generalizable to the real world.

Additionally, clinical trials should focus on outcomes that matter to patients, like the quality of life and functional recovery. This is especially important when it comes to trials that involve invasive procedures or those with potential serious adverse events. Methods

In a practical study it is the intention to inform clinical or policy decisions by demonstrating how an intervention can be integrated into routine care in real-world settings. Explanatory trials test hypotheses about the cause-effect relationship within idealised settings. Therefore, pragmatic trials could have less internal validity than explanatory trials, and could be more susceptible to bias in their design, conduct, and analysis. The PRECIS-2 tool assesses the degree of pragmatism in an RCT by scoring it across 9 domains ranging from 1 (very explicative) to 5 (very pragmatic). In this study the areas of recruitment, organisation and flexibility in delivery, flexible adherence, and follow-up scored high. However, the primary outcome and method of missing data were scored below the practical limit. This suggests that a trial can be designed with good practical features, but without damaging the quality.

It is, however, difficult to assess how practical a particular trial is since pragmatism is not a binary quality; certain aspects of a trial may be more pragmatic than others. Moreover, protocol or logistic changes during the trial may alter its pragmatism score. Many studies have attempted classify pragmatic trials using a variety of definitions and scoring methods. Schwartz and Lellouch1 created a framework for distinguishing between research studies that prove a clinical or physiological hypothesis, and pragmatic trials that aid in the selection of appropriate therapies in clinical practice. The framework was comprised of nine domains scored on a 1-5 scale with 1 being more explanatory while 5 was more pragmatic. The domains were recruitment and setting, delivery of intervention with flexibility, follow-up and primary analysis.

The initial PRECIS tool3 featured similar domains and an assessment scale ranging from 1 to 5. Koppenaal et al10 created an adaptation of this assessment, dubbed the Pragmascope that was easier to use in systematic reviews. They discovered that pragmatic systematic reviews had a higher average score in most domains, but lower scores in the primary analysis domain.

The difference in the analysis domain that is primary could be explained by the fact that most pragmatic trials analyze their data in the intention to treat manner however some explanation trials do not. The overall score was lower for systematic reviews that were pragmatic when the domains of organisation, flexible delivery, and follow-up were combined.

It is important to understand that a pragmatic trial doesn't necessarily mean a low-quality trial, and indeed there is an increasing number of clinical trials (as defined by MEDLINE search, but this is neither specific or sensitive) that use the term "pragmatic" in their abstracts or titles. These terms may signal that there is a greater appreciation of pragmatism in titles and abstracts, but it's not clear if this is reflected in content.

Conclusions

As the importance of real-world evidence grows popular, pragmatic trials have gained momentum in research. They are randomized trials that evaluate real-world care alternatives to experimental treatments in development. They are conducted with populations of patients more closely resembling those treated in regular medical care. This approach could help overcome the limitations of observational studies that are prone to biases associated with reliance on volunteers, and the limited availability and the variability of coding in national registry systems.

Other advantages of pragmatic trials are the ability to use existing data sources, as well as a higher likelihood of detecting meaningful changes than traditional trials. However, these trials could be prone to limitations that compromise their validity and generalizability. For example the rates of participation in some trials may be lower than expected due to the healthy-volunteer effect and financial incentives or competition for participants from other research studies (e.g., industry trials). Practical trials are often limited by the need to recruit participants in a timely manner. Practical trials aren't always equipped with controls to ensure that any observed differences aren't caused by biases that occur during the trial.
